Law – One of the World’s Leading Law Schools - University of Melbourne

Melbourne Law School is one of the most prestigious law schools globally and one of the oldest in Australia. It is widely recognized for its excellence in teaching, research, and a powerful global alumni network working across top law firms, multinational corporations, government bodies, and international organisations.

The teaching approach focuses on case-based learning, interactive class discussions, and Moot Court simulations, helping students develop critical thinking, communication, and problem-solving skills. Students also gain real-world experience through opportunities such as the Melbourne Law Clinic and internships with law firms, government agencies, and international organisations.

Due to the Melbourne Model, the University of Melbourne does not offer a direct Bachelor of Laws (LLB). Instead, students typically choose degrees such as Bachelor of Arts, Bachelor of Commerce and Bachelor of Health Sciences. They can then specialise through Breadth subjects in areas like:

  • AI and the Law
  • Business Law
  • Business and Taxation Law
  • Media and Intellectual Property Law

Study Medicine at University of Melbourne

The University of Melbourne is internationally recognised as one of Australia’s leading institutions for Medicine and Health Sciences. Renowned for its excellence in medical education, clinical training, and world-class research, the university prepares future healthcare professionals to make a meaningful impact on patient care and global health.

Students benefit from close partnerships with some of Australia’s most prestigious teaching hospitals, including Royal Melbourne Hospital, Peter MacCallum Cancer Centre, and Royal Children’s Hospital. These collaborations provide valuable opportunities to gain real clinical experience and learn directly from experienced healthcare professionals.

The curriculum combines foundational medical sciences, clinical skills training, and hands-on hospital placements. Students develop practical experience in advanced Simulation Labs before progressing to clinical rotations in real healthcare settings, ensuring they graduate with the confidence and skills required for modern medical practice.

The University of Melbourne is also a global leader in medical research, with internationally recognised expertise in:

  • Cancer Research
  • Neuroscience
  • Public Health
  • Precision Medicine
  • Infectious Diseases

Students have opportunities to participate in cutting-edge research projects alongside leading clinicians and scientists, contributing to innovations that improve healthcare worldwide.

Study Engineering at University of Melbourne

The University of Melbourne is home to one of Australia’s most prestigious engineering schools, recognised globally for its excellence in engineering education, research, and industry collaboration. The faculty is particularly renowned for its expertise in structural engineering, smart cities, sustainable infrastructure, and advanced engineering technologies.

The curriculum combines strong engineering fundamentals with practical design, innovation, and real-world problem-solving. Students gain hands-on experience through cutting-edge laboratories, collaborative design projects, and industry-based learning, preparing them to tackle complex engineering challenges in a rapidly changing world.

A key feature of the program is the opportunity to work on Capstone Projects and Industry Projects, where students collaborate with engineering firms, construction companies, and government organisations to solve real engineering problems. These experiences help graduates develop technical, communication, and project management skills that are highly valued by employers.

The engineering programs are also accredited by Engineers Australia, providing graduates with a strong foundation for pursuing professional engineering registration in Australia, subject to the relevant accreditation and licensing requirements.

Study Veterinary Science at University of Melbourne

The University of Melbourne is internationally recognised for its excellence in Veterinary Science, offering one of Australia’s most respected programs in animal health, veterinary medicine, and biomedical research. The university prepares future veterinarians and animal health professionals through a combination of world-class teaching, clinical training, and research.

A key advantage of studying Veterinary Science at the University of Melbourne is access to the U-Vet Werribee Animal Hospital, a state-of-the-art teaching hospital where students gain practical experience treating companion animals, livestock, and wildlife under the supervision of experienced veterinarians and clinical specialists.

The curriculum combines classroom learning with extensive hands-on clinical practice, enabling students to develop essential diagnostic, surgical, and animal care skills. In addition to clinical training, students have opportunities to participate in internationally recognised research in areas such as:

  • Animal Health and Disease Prevention
  • Food Safety and Biosecurity
  • Livestock Production
  • Wildlife Conservation
  • One Health and Zoonotic Diseases

These experiences prepare graduates to address global challenges in animal welfare, sustainable agriculture, and public health.
